Incident Narrative
A road project was utilizing two excavator mounted drilling attachments, which have telescoping Kelly bars to make the drill bit go down into the ground. Two mechanics came out to inspect the Kelly bars. The injured mechanic was facing the excavator operator and signaled the operator to raise the boom, but the Kelly bar raised/collapsed instead. The injured mechanic s right hand slipped into the inner and outer Kelly bars of the drill and the first, middle, and ring fingers were injured. The top of one of the fingers was surgically amputated.
